There is no officially recognized certification called "Certified Professional in Comedy of Menace." The term "Comedy of Menace" refers to a specific genre of comedic writing and performance, characterized by dark humor, unsettling situations, and often unpredictable characters. Therefore, there are no established learning outcomes, durations, or formalized certifications directly related to this specific term.


However, skills relevant to mastering the "Comedy of Menace" genre are developed through various comedic writing and performance courses or workshops. These might encompass aspects of comedic timing, character development, scriptwriting, improvisation, and dark humor techniques. These skills are highly relevant in the entertainment industry, particularly for aspiring writers, actors, and comedians working in television, film, theater, and stand-up comedy.


To gain proficiency in this area, aspiring professionals should seek training in comedic writing, acting, and improvisation, focusing on developing a strong understanding of character archetypes, plot construction, and the nuances of dark humor.
